New Opinion Creates Split in Western District as to Whether Debtors Can Exempt Undisclosed Tax Refund That is Spent Post-petition.
In re O'Brien, Bankr. W.D. Mich., Jan. 4, 2011 (Case No. 09-00426, Hon. James D. Gregg). As previously discussed on this blog, debtors should include a good-faith estimate of an anticipated tax refund in their bankruptcy schedules. In prior cases
